recoup
recoup calculates and visualizes signal profiles from short sequence reads generated by Next Generation Sequencing (NGS) to support analysis of ChIP-Seq and RNA-Seq experiments.
Key Features:
- Signal Profile Calculation: recoup summarizes sequencing read data into curve profiles or heatmap profiles to represent aggregated and detailed signal distributions.
- Visualization Libraries: recoup generates plots using ggplot2 and ComplexHeatmap within the R programming environment.
- Genomic Data Support: recoup is tailored for generating genomic profile plots from ChIP-Seq and RNA-Seq datasets.
Scientific Applications:
- ChIP-Seq Analysis: Visualize protein–DNA interaction profiles to aid identification of regulatory elements.
- RNA-Seq Data Interpretation: Examine gene expression profiles across conditions or tissues to inform transcriptional regulation analyses.
Methodology:
recoup operates within the Bioconductor framework using the R programming language, computes signal profiles from sequencing reads as curve or heatmap representations, and leverages ggplot2 and ComplexHeatmap for visualization.
